The kaon's glue and sea distributions are similar to those in the pion, although the inclusion of mass-dependent splitting functions introduces some differences on the valence-quark domain. The π+π- rescattering model predicts a two-photon effective mass spectrum peaked at slightly higher mγγ than in chiral perturbation theory, and a branching ratio B(KL→π0γγ)≈7.5×10-7. Implications are discussed for the corresponding decay of the charged kaon....
